DEATHS. THOMAS.-On September 4, 1944, Major George

Trevor Harley Thomas, RA.M.C., Retired. Born in Pimlico, London, March 19, 1860, he took the L.S.A. in 1881, the M.RC.S., England, in 1882, and the F.RC.S. Edinburgh, in' 1889. Commissioned Surgeon February 3, 1883, he was promoted Surgeon Major February 3, 1895, and retired as Major RA.M.C. August 26, 1903. During the Great War he was re-.employed from August 5, 1914, till January 31, 1918. He served

\ in South Africa 1899-1902 taking part in the actions at Colesberg January 15, 1900, to Feb­ruary 12, 1900, and operations in the Orange

River Colony, being·awarded the Queen:s Medai with two Clasps and the King's Medal with two Clasps.

OFFICER.-Major John Moore Officer, RA.M.C., who was taken prisoner at the fall of Hong Kong, is now presumed Killed in Action, October 1-2, 1942, whilst a prisoner of war in Japanese hands. Major Officer was born May 31, 1907, and took the M.B. Edinburgh, in 1930. Commissioned Lieutenant September 17, 1930, he was promoterl Captain March 17,1934, and Major September 17, 1940.

ROYAL ARMY MEDICAL CORPS AND ARMY DENTAL CORPS COMFORTS GlJILD '

\VE are publishing this month our Annual Balance Sheet, and. Lady Hood and the Committee acknow-

• edge with extreme gratitude the many marvellous donations that have come in to the Fund during. the last year and which' have enabled us to do so much for the R.A.M.C. prisoners of war and for 'the men serving overseas. We want also to express a special word of thanks to our friends who are

giving' up so much of their time to knit comforts for the men.

Mrs. Richmond, who has put in a lot ot work during the last three years as Hon. Secretary, has now left the country, and Mrs. Sandiford has taken over the duties of Hon. Secretary and Mrs. McGrigor has become the Hon. Treasurer. R.,·1.M.C. Headquarters Mes" . P. M. SANDlFURD,

Millbank, London, S. W. L Hon. Secretary.
